Record breaking win for Sheikh Jamal
Dhaka, June 28, 2015: Holders Sheikh Jamal
started the second phase of the Manyavar Bangladesh Premier League with a
record breaking 9-1 win against Farashganj SC at the Bangabandhu National
Stadium on Sunday.
Jamal beat Uttar Baridhara 8-0 last
season to set the record of the biggest win the premier league.
Gambian forward Landing Darboe put
Jamal ahead in the 8th minute when midfielder Alamgir Kabir Rana cut a square
pass to the Gambian whose cracking grounder landed into the near post (1-0)
Haitian striker Wedson Anselme
scored his seventh league goal in the 26th minute from a low cross of Landing
Darboe (2-0)
Farashganj reduced the margin in the
38th minute and it was a superb strike of Nigerian forward Akinyele Peter.
Peter dribbled past Yamin Munna and Keshto Kumar before slotting the ball in
the far post (2-1)
However Jamal’s two goal lead was
back in the 45th minute when Wedson scored his second of the match with a
diving header on a cross of Sohel Rana (3-1)
Wedson completed his hat-trick in
the 52nd minute when he made his way through the Farashganj defence with a lob
of Landing Darboe and kept his cool to beat goalie Sujan Chowdhury in the near
post (4-1)
Maunul Islam scored the fifth in the
53rd minute off a penalty (5-1)
Wedson took his tally to ten goal in
the 66th minute capitalizing a low cross of Mamunul Islam (6-1)
The seventh goal was netted by
Mamunul Islam in the 73rd minute as his curving left footer from 20
yards looped into the net (7-1)
The eighth goal was scored by Taklis
Ahmed in the 83rd minute when
he received a cross at the top of the box and placed the ball past onrushing
Sujan Chowdhury (8-1)
Mamunul Islam completed his first hat-trick and ninth goal for Jamal with a powerful left footer form 30 yards in the 90th minute. (9-1)
After this win, Sheikh Jamal took their tally to 26 points playing 11 matches while Farashganj remained with 4 points playing 11 matches also.
